About OWL files
OWL files are a type of file format used to store data in the form of ontologies. Ontologies are a way of representing knowledge in a structured way, and they are used in many fields, such as artificial intelligence, natural language processing, and bioinformatics. OWL files are usually written in the Web Ontology Language (OWL), which is an XML-based language for representing ontologies. OWL files are typically used to store data about entities, relationships, and other information related to a particular domain.
There are several ways to convert OWL files to other formats. For example, the OWLReady2 library can be used to convert OWL files to RDF/XML, Turtle, and other formats. Additionally, the Protg ontology editor can be used to convert OWL files to various formats, including OWL/XML, RDF/XML, and Manchester OWL Syntax.
When converting OWL files, it is important to consider the complexity of the ontology. OWL files can contain complex relationships between entities, and these can be difficult to represent in other formats. Additionally, OWL files can contain multiple ontologies, which can further complicate the conversion process.
